#66413B Hex color

#66413B

The hexadecimal color code #66413B corresponds to the code RGB( 102, 65, 59 ). It's a shade of Red. This color is a combination of red (at 0,40 level), green (at 0,25 level) and blue (at 0,23 level). Its brightness is 31% and its saturation is 26%. It is composed of red at 45%, green at 28% and blue at 26%.
